24K
I say it all depends who's playing after you. Find out what speed the DJ after you is playing and either play at the same speed or a tad slower. Depending on how many people are there when you play,,, I don't think there's any point blasting out your HUGE tunes for an opening set if nobody is there. Take enough recs with you so that you can go if a few diffrent directions depending on the situation =)

unless you're a super star dj, you're more than likely in the position where pleasing the crowd may not necessarily mean pleasing yourself. for instance, you may be a hard trance addict, but you could only get a gig playing trance. for someone like tiesto it doesnt matter, he plays melodic techtrance and people came to hear him play melodic techtrance, but in your case it sounds like you like to play more powerful stuff in a situation where you may have to tone it down.

SO, play what you like, always, thats true, develop a style, but learn to like different types of tunes. for instance, find a couple progressive tracks, downtempo tracks, techy tracks that you like and fit your style so that in situations where you're opening, closing, or sustaining a party, you have some to play in your style (respectively).

i agree prog opens great. i like tracks like Way Out West - mindicrus (g&d mix), andain - beautiful things (g&d), jxl tunes, throw in some sasha, etc. or go the more tribal house/prog route with tracks by PQM, chab, nukem.
